After nearly an entire weeks worth of work, here is my entry into Stevencho's mini competition! :D

The theme of the competition is remakes of 10+ year old games, so Jet Set Radio was the perfect choice for me. since I doubt we will get another JSR game anytime soon. D;
Since custom artwork is encoraged,besides the graffiti, the box is pretty much all hand drawn / redrawn artwork. I took various design elements from the old dreamcast JSR boxarts and incorporated them into my box.
